Far from Beijing, technician eyeing capital's skies

By Xin Wen | China Daily | Updated: 2018-04-18 07:52

Zhou Huaigang was glad to finally have a chance to spend a warm Spring Festival with his family this year. For more than 20 years, he didn't have the opportunity to attend family dinners during the all-important holiday as he was always on duty at the China Regional Atmosphere Watch Station.

His promotion and the employment of more staff allowed him to go home this year.

The station - 150 kilometers northeast of Beijing in Shangdianzi village, near Miyun Reservoir - is one of six Chinese global baseline stations established by the World Meteorological Organization.
